Quick Q, might split into another thread if there's interest.

I'm in the last 4 weeks of my current "block" hence focussing on keeping explosive bouldering in the mix but less of a focus (once per week) and otherwise doing some base endurance (consistent climbing for 10-20 mins for one session per week as a warm up to doing some more focussed / peak / aeropow type work.

My question is about in-session volume and when to stop?  Last night I did about 200m of climbing between 6b (continuity) and 7b - limit onsight* (*not strictly training the right "systems" but fun and good to keep skills focussed)

Other work I've been doing is circuits at TCA for which I've been doing double laps at around or just below onsight level, with 15s to 1m rest between the two laps, depending on difficulty.

So, thoughts - when should you stop?  I've usually got a good sense of when I'm hitting diminishing returns with power / stregth stuff and stop relatively early but I'm not sure if I should be focussing more on quality and less on volume?
